Key Inflammatory Markers

When you have IBD, your healthcare team monitors inflammatory markers—objective measurements that indicate how much inflammation is present in your body. These markers are important tools for assessing disease activity, but understanding their strengths and limitations helps you interpret your lab results with appropriate context. Three commonly tracked markers are fecal calprotectin, C-reactive protein (CRP), and erythrocyte sedimentation rate (ESR).

Fecal calprotectin is a protein found in stool that reflects inflammation in the gut itself. It's particularly useful for IBD because it directly measures intestinal inflammation—the core problem in your disease. A normal fecal calprotectin is generally below 50 mcg/g, and levels above 250 mcg/g typically indicate active inflammation. The strength of this marker is its specificity to the gut, but it can also be elevated in other conditions affecting the intestines. CRP and ESR are systemic markers that measure inflammation throughout your body. CRP is produced by the liver in response to inflammation, while ESR measures how quickly red blood cells settle in a test tube—a process accelerated by inflammation. Both are helpful for understanding overall inflammatory burden, but they're less specific to IBD than fecal calprotectin and can be affected by conditions beyond your gut disease, such as infections or autoimmune conditions.

Tracking Trends, Not Snapshots

A single lab result is like a photograph—it captures a moment in time, but it doesn't tell the whole story. Your inflammatory markers fluctuate daily, influenced by stress, diet, sleep, infections, and the natural variability of your disease. A fecal calprotectin result of 180 mcg/g might seem alarming, but what matters more is whether it's trending upward from 80 mcg/g last month, stable at 150-200 for several months, or declining from 400 three months ago. Context transforms raw numbers into meaningful information.

This is why maintaining a log of your lab results over time is invaluable. Create a simple spreadsheet with dates and your key markers—fecal calprotectin, CRP, ESR if available—and track them over months and years. Note when you started new medications, made dietary changes, or experienced significant life stressors, and see if your markers responded accordingly. Over time, you'll develop intuition about what your numbers mean specifically for you. You might notice that your markers correlate strongly with your symptoms, or you might discover that you can feel reasonably well despite somewhat elevated lab values. You'll learn whether gradual increase warrants a treatment change or whether your disease tends to plateau at certain levels before improving. This longitudinal perspective is far more useful than any single test result.

Beyond the Numbers

Laboratory markers are objective measurements, and that objectivity is valuable—but they're not the whole truth about your disease. Some patients with elevated inflammatory markers feel well, while others with normal markers struggle with symptoms. This clinical-biochemical disconnect happens because the relationship between intestinal inflammation and symptom experience is complex. You might have microscopic inflammation that doesn't yet cause noticeable symptoms, or your symptoms might reflect previous inflammation that's now healing but hasn't fully resolved on tests yet. Additionally, symptoms can result from factors other than active inflammation—strictures that narrow your bowel, post-inflammatory changes, or even psychological factors like anxiety.

This is why the most complete picture of your disease comes from combining lab markers with your symptom experience and your doctor's clinical assessment. Report your symptoms honestly and thoroughly—don't downplay how you're actually feeling because your lab values look acceptable, and don't assume you're in remission just because you feel good if your markers tell a different story. When your symptoms and your lab results diverge, that disconnect is important information that should prompt a conversation with your doctor. It might mean you need additional investigation, a medication adjustment, or simply acknowledgment that your disease is more complex than the markers alone suggest. Your experience matters as much as your lab values, and the best treatment decisions come from honoring both.
